It's official. Youssef Chermiti is joining Rangers, from Scotland, having signed a contract valid for the next four seasons. After two seasons at the emblem of the city of Liverpool, which signed him from Sporting, of Ruben Amorim, the forward is moving to the Scottish runner-up.

Although the values of the deal were not revealed, the English press points to a transfer that was closed for 9.2 million euros, plus 2.3 million contingent on the achievement of objectives. The player said he is excited about the new challenge.

"I can't wait to meet everyone, my teammates and all the staff. I just want to get to know everyone and get involved. I've heard about the atmosphere here, about the stadium and I can't wait to play", said the 21-year-old Portuguese international, quoted by the Scottish club.

Rangers were recently eliminated from the Champions League playoff against Club Brugge (9-1 on aggregate) and were relegated to the Europa League. The Scottish team lost the first match, at home, by 3-1 and was thrashed in Belgium by 6-0 . The Belgian emblem will face Sporting in the millionaire competition.

In the summer market of 2023, the forward moved to Everton, in a deal in which the Alvalade Club earned a sum around 12.5 million euros. In England, he has not yet scored any goal in 24 matches played in the main team of the English squad.
